Misconceptions Concerning LASIK Pain
In contrast to popular belief, LASIK surgical treatment isn't as painful as many people believe. The treatment itself is relatively quick and painless. You may feel some stress or discomfort during the surgical treatment, however it's normally very little. The specialist will certainly make use of numbing eye drops to make certain that you don't feel any pain throughout the process.
While it's regular to experience some dryness, irritation, or moderate discomfort in the hours adhering to the surgical treatment, this can generally be taken care of with over the counter pain medication and eye decreases. It is necessary to follow your medical professional's post-operative treatment directions to decrease any type of discomfort and promote appropriate recovery.
Bear in mind that everybody's discomfort tolerance is various, so what someone might refer to as uncomfortable may be entirely tolerable for one more. Rest assured that LASIK pain is typically not a major worry and shouldn't hinder you from considering this life-changing procedure.
Risks Related To LASIK
Numerous individuals going through LASIK surgical treatment are primarily worried regarding potential risks associated with the treatment. While LASIK is a secure and reliable therapy for vision Correction, like any procedure, it does come with some dangers.
One of the most common risks related to LASIK include complet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and trouble driving at evening in the prompt postoperative period. These signs and symptoms are usually momentary and boost as the eyes heal.
In unusual situations, more severe difficulties such as infection, corneal flap problems, and vision loss can occur, however the likelihood of these complications is extremely low when the surgical treatment is performed by a competent and experienced eye doctor. It is very important to discuss these dangers with your doctor during the examination to guarantee you have a clear understanding of what to expect.
